The highly anticipated 3rd Season of Telltale’s ongoing series of Walking Dead adventure games is almost upon us, and this year’s Game Awards gave us a fresh new look at what the game has in store for us. Spoiler Alert! It’s a whole lot of sadness and depression.

Following on from the announcement last month that the series is set to be released December 20th, it has now been revealed that the premiere will last through two episodes due to the enormity of the story being told. This means come release day, fans will be sitting down to play two brand new action-packed episodes, with the rest releasing throughout 2017. In addition to this exciting news, Telltale also released an extended trailer for the game, detailing the tragic origins of new playable character Javier.
The game takes place 4 years into the apocalypse, two years after the events of Season 2, featuring a much older Clementine as she meets Javier:
“As Javier, a young man determined to find the family taken from him, you meet a young girl who has experienced her own unimaginable loss. Her name is Clementine, and your fates are bound together in a story where every choice you make could be your last.”
The game will follow the same format as all the others in the series, with the player interacting with the dramatic story that unfolds, with every decision you make informing who lives, and who dies.
Telltale’s ‘The Walking Dead: A New Frontier’ Episodes 1 and 2 release on PC, PS4 and XBOX ONE December 20th, 2016.
